Jimmy Lewis - Two Women - Has It Ever Been Booted?
Not booted according to Manships Guide 5th Edition. According to the guide, the A side is We Can Make It. The Label is:- Tangerine 987 - guide price is £15. ATB Mike

Good Stuff To Do In London Over This Weekend?
Hi Godz Assume your going to the 100 Club. The Blue Posts PH is the pre 100 club watering hole which is at the corner of Eastcastle Street/ Newman Street. I like the Dog & Duck in Frith Street which serves good real Ales. For used soul vinyl, there are a couple of shops on Hanway Street which is at the Tottenham Court Road end of Oxford Street. Otherwise, Exotica or Rough Trade on Portobello Road and there is also a great Market there too. I would recommend The Golden Hind Fish & Chip Restaurant in Marylebone Lane, W1. It's unpretentious, inexpensive and you can also take your own bottle of wine or beer in there too. You may need to book Whatever you do, hope you have a great time. ATB Mike
